Which THAAD element serves as the electrical pathway for power and MRP data to and from the transporter?

Explanation:
The element that provides the electrical pathway for power and MRP data to and from the transporter is the ADUIL-JB. This junction box is designed to tie together the transporter's power connections with the data lines used by the MRP system, serving as the centralized conduit for both power delivery and signaling between the transporter and the launcher’s electronics. In this setup, power and MRP data can be reliably routed to and from the launcher components, while other items play different roles: the Launcher Control and Communication Unit handles commands and communications, the MRP Rack processes mission readiness data, and the Shock Indicator monitors impact or shock. So the ADUIL-JB is specifically the component that serves as the electrical pathway linking the transporter to the launcher’s power and data systems.
